An entry-level AI job is a position designed for individuals who are new to the field of artificial intelligence. These roles provide an opportunity to build foundational skills and gain practical experience in AI technologies and methodologies. They are ideal for recent graduates, career changers, or professionals transitioning from related fields such as data science, software development, or engineering.
Junior Data Scientists are responsible for analyzing large datasets to extract meaningful insights and build predictive models. They often work closely with senior data scientists and cross-functional teams to support data-driven decision-making processes.
AI/ML Engineers develop and implement machine learning models and algorithms. They work on improving existing AI systems and contribute to the development of new AI-based solutions.
Data Analysts collect, clean, and interpret data to help organizations make informed decisions. They create visualizations and dashboards that present data insights in an understandable format.
NLP Specialists focus on natural language processing tasks such as text classification, sentiment analysis, and language modeling. They work on projects that involve understanding and generating human language using AI techniques.
AI Content Writers create both technical and non-technical content related to artificial intelligence. They translate complex AI concepts into understandable material for diverse audiences.
Data Annotators label and annotate data to train supervised learning models. This role is essential for improving the accuracy and performance of AI algorithms.
Technical Support Specialists assist users in troubleshooting AI-powered tools and software. They provide documentation and educate customers on the functionalities of AI applications.
A bachelor's degree in computer science, data science, artificial intelligence, or related fields is commonly required for entry-level AI positions. However, some roles may accept equivalent experience, certifications, or training from reputable bootcamps and online platforms.

Showcasing your skills through a portfolio is crucial. Include personal projects, contributions to open-source AI projects, or participation in competitions like Kaggle. A well-maintained GitHub repository displaying your work can make a significant difference.
Internships and co-op programs provide hands-on experience. They offer exposure to real-world AI applications and the opportunity to work alongside experienced professionals. Practical experience is often highly valued by employers.
Building a professional network is essential. Attend AI conferences, join online communities, and connect with industry professionals on platforms like LinkedIn. Networking can lead to mentorship opportunities and job referrals.
Create a targeted resume by highlighting relevant coursework, projects, and skills that align with the specific job description. Emphasize your technical skills, problem-solving abilities, and any practical experience you have.
Engage in AI competitions and hackathons to test and demonstrate your skills. These events provide practical challenges that can help you learn new techniques and showcase your abilities to potential employers.
Tech giants like Google, IBM, Amazon, and Microsoft are primary employers of entry-level AI professionals. These companies offer a range of roles from AI engineering to data science.
The healthcare industry leverages AI for diagnostics, personalized medicine, and operational efficiency. Entry-level roles may involve working with medical data, developing predictive models, or improving healthcare technologies.
Financial institutions utilize AI for fraud detection, algorithmic trading, and customer service automation. Entry-level AI jobs in finance often focus on data analysis and model development.
AI is used in retail for inventory management, customer personalization, and supply chain optimization. Entry-level positions may involve data analysis, developing recommendation systems, or improving customer experience through AI.
Educational institutions and EdTech companies use AI for adaptive learning, student performance analysis, and administrative efficiency. Entry-level roles may focus on developing educational tools or analyzing educational data.
Salaries for entry-level AI positions vary based on role, industry, and geographic location. Here is a summary of average salary ranges:
Job Title | Average Salary (USD) |
---|---|
Junior Data Scientist | $81,180 - $102,042 |
AI/ML Engineer (Junior Level) | $75,000 - $95,000 |
Data Analyst | $60,000 - $80,000 |
NLP Specialist (Junior Level) | $70,000 - $90,000 |
AI Content Writer | $50,000 - $70,000 |
Data Annotator | $40,000 - $60,000 |
Technical Support Specialist (AI Tools) | $45,000 - $65,000 |
